    I thought this place would be nicer. We walked in soon after opening. There's two bars, one downstairs and one in the loft in the upstairs area. When we went, only the downstairs bar was available. The bartender was seemingly very knowledgeable with his drinks and alcohol, and there was only him serving everyone, so it might take a bit to get your drinks. Going upstairs to sit, I was disappointed that the 'library' was just wallpaper. It would be nice if there were more books. Everything was a bit run down, from the chairs to the tables. And a little lackluster with the drinks. I really didn't like that they already tack on a 20% tip, but then also offer tip suggestions on the bottom of the receipt.

    Based on the reviews and photos, I had this on my "Philly bucket list" and was excited to take my parents for a post-dinner cocktail here during their visit. The whole experience left me a little cold - atmosphere, cocktails, and service all squarely "just okay." Ambiance-wise, I found Writer's Block to be a little more gimmick than anything else. I LOVE the globe lighting fixture on the second floor but I was confused about how the wallpaper and book-themed menu played into the rest of the experience. I was hoping this might be a "creative's hub" of sorts where one could come and comfortably curl up with a book or journal, but that is not really the vibe at all. I solo travel and solo explore quite a bit and this would not be a place I'd return to, even to saddle up at the bar. Figuring out what to do upon walking in the door was also bizarre given how cramped the space is. Do I head upstairs? Over to the bar? Wait here? From there I found my aperol spritz to be good (hard to screw with a spritz tho, let's be real) and both of my parents cocktails to be okay, balance and creativity-wise. Serve staff did seem fairly miserable to be there across the board and I can't really blame them - lots of hauling up and down stairs and I am sure a wide range of folks coming through the (cramped) door. I guess I just wish there was a little more definition and thoughtfulness put into the "theme" - something I think one could almost get away with if the cocktail program had been phenomenal. Overall a fine experience if you're looking for a drink in a moody environment, but not a place I am apt to return to soon.
